.svc-main{background:var(--black);min-height:100vh}.svc-tiers-section{padding:7rem 4rem;background:var(--studio)}.svc-tiers-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:1px;background:hsla(0,0%,100%,.05)}.svc-spec-section{padding:7rem 4rem;background:var(--black)}.svc-spec-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:1px;background:hsla(0,0%,100%,.05)}.svc-retainer-section{padding:5rem 4rem;background:var(--studio);border-top:.5px solid hsla(0,0%,100%,.05);border-bottom:.5px solid hsla(0,0%,100%,.05)}.svc-retainer-inner{background:var(--black);border:.5px solid hsla(39,45%,61%,.15);padding:4rem;display:grid;grid-template-columns:1fr auto;gap:5rem;align-items:start}.svc-retainer-list{list-style:none;display:grid;grid-template-columns:1fr 1fr;gap:.6rem 2rem}.svc-retainer-price{text-align:right;flex-shrink:0;display:flex;flex-direction:column;align-items:flex-end;gap:.5rem}.svc-strategy-section{padding:7rem 4rem;background:var(--black)}.svc-strategy-inner{border:.5px solid hsla(0,0%,100%,.06);padding:4rem;display:grid;grid-template-columns:1fr 1fr;gap:5rem;align-items:start}.svc-rules-section{padding:5rem 4rem;background:var(--studio);border-top:.5px solid hsla(0,0%,100%,.05)}.svc-rules-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:1px;background:hsla(0,0%,100%,.04)}.tier-card{background:var(--studio);padding:3rem 2.5rem;display:flex;flex-direction:column;position:relative;transition:background .4s}.tier-card:hover{background:#181818}.tier-card.featured{background:var(--shadow);border-top:1px solid var(--gold)}.tier-card.featured:hover{background:#222}.tier-badge{display:inline-block;font-size:.6rem;letter-spacing:.2em;text-transform:uppercase;color:var(--gold);border:.5px solid hsla(39,45%,61%,.3);padding:.3rem .8rem;margin-bottom:1.5rem;align-self:flex-start}.tier-name{font-family:Cormorant Garamond,serif;font-weight:400;font-size:2.2rem;color:var(--white);margin-bottom:.25rem;line-height:1}.tier-price-row{font-size:.75rem;letter-spacing:.1em;color:hsla(0,0%,100%,.35);margin-bottom:1.75rem;text-transform:uppercase}.tier-price{font-size:1.1rem;color:var(--film);font-weight:400;letter-spacing:0;margin-right:.25rem}.tier-divider{border:none;border-top:.5px solid hsla(0,0%,100%,.07);margin-bottom:1.75rem}.tier-desc{font-size:.83rem;color:hsla(0,0%,100%,.45);line-height:1.8;margin-bottom:1.75rem;font-weight:300}.tier-includes{list-style:none;display:flex;flex-direction:column;gap:.6rem;margin-bottom:2.5rem;flex:1}.tier-item{font-size:.8rem;color:hsla(0,0%,100%,.5);display:flex;align-items:baseline;gap:.75rem;font-weight:300}.tier-dash{color:hsla(39,45%,61%,.4);flex-shrink:0;font-size:.7rem}.tier-cta{display:inline-block;font-size:.7rem;letter-spacing:.18em;text-transform:uppercase;text-decoration:none;border:.5px solid hsla(0,0%,100%,.12);padding:.8rem 1.5rem;text-align:center;transition:all .3s;margin-top:auto;color:hsla(0,0%,100%,.5);background:transparent}.tier-cta.featured{border:none;color:var(--black);background:var(--gold)}.spec-card{background:var(--black);padding:2.75rem;transition:background .4s}.spec-card:hover{background:var(--studio)}.spec-cat{font-size:.6rem;letter-spacing:.2em;text-transform:uppercase;color:var(--gold);margin-bottom:.75rem;opacity:.7}.spec-name{font-family:Cormorant Garamond,serif;font-weight:400;font-size:1.5rem;color:var(--white);margin-bottom:.75rem;line-height:1.2}.spec-desc{font-size:.82rem;color:hsla(0,0%,100%,.4);line-height:1.8;margin-bottom:1.5rem;font-weight:300}.spec-price{font-size:.72rem;letter-spacing:.12em;text-transform:uppercase;color:hsla(0,0%,100%,.3)}.spec-price.custom{color:var(--gold)}.retainer-eyebrow{font-size:.6rem;letter-spacing:.25em;text-transform:uppercase;color:var(--gold);margin-bottom:1.25rem;opacity:.7}.retainer-headline{font-family:Cormorant Garamond,serif;font-weight:300;font-size:2.2rem;color:var(--white);margin-bottom:1rem;line-height:1.1}.retainer-desc{font-size:.88rem;line-height:1.9;margin-bottom:2rem;max-width:500px}.retainer-desc,.retainer-item{color:hsla(0,0%,100%,.45);font-weight:300}.retainer-item{font-size:.8rem;display:flex;align-items:baseline;gap:.75rem}.retainer-dash{color:hsla(39,45%,61%,.4);flex-shrink:0;font-size:.7rem}.retainer-from{font-size:.6rem;letter-spacing:.2em;text-transform:uppercase;color:hsla(0,0%,100%,.25)}.retainer-amount{font-family:Cormorant Garamond,serif;font-weight:300;font-size:3.5rem;color:var(--white);line-height:1}.retainer-period{font-size:.7rem;letter-spacing:.1em;text-transform:uppercase;color:hsla(0,0%,100%,.25);margin-bottom:1.5rem}.retainer-commitment{font-size:.65rem;color:hsla(0,0%,100%,.2);letter-spacing:.08em;margin-bottom:1.5rem}.strategy-headline{font-family:Cormorant Garamond,serif;font-weight:300;font-size:2rem;color:var(--white);margin-bottom:1.25rem;line-height:1.2}.strategy-desc{font-size:.88rem;color:hsla(0,0%,100%,.45);line-height:1.9;font-weight:300;margin-bottom:1.5rem}.strategy-price-note{font-size:.72rem;letter-spacing:.12em;text-transform:uppercase;color:hsla(0,0%,100%,.3)}.strategy-price-strong{color:var(--film);font-weight:400;font-size:.9rem}.strategy-list{display:flex;flex-direction:column;gap:1.5rem}.strategy-item{padding-bottom:1.5rem;border-bottom:.5px solid hsla(0,0%,100%,.05)}.strategy-item:last-child{border-bottom:none;padding-bottom:0}.strategy-item-name{font-family:Cormorant Garamond,serif;font-size:1.1rem;color:var(--white);margin-bottom:.4rem}.strategy-item-desc{font-size:.8rem;color:hsla(0,0%,100%,.35);line-height:1.7;font-weight:300}.rule-card{background:var(--studio);padding:2rem}.rule-num{font-family:Cormorant Garamond,serif;font-size:.85rem;color:var(--gold);opacity:.5;margin-bottom:.75rem}.rule-title{font-size:.82rem;font-weight:500;color:var(--white);margin-bottom:.5rem}.rule-desc{font-size:.78rem;color:hsla(0,0%,100%,.35);line-height:1.7;font-weight:300}.svc-closer{padding:9rem 4rem;background:var(--black);display:flex;flex-direction:column;align-items:center;text-align:center}.svc-closer-eyebrow{font-size:.65rem;letter-spacing:.25em;text-transform:uppercase;color:hsla(0,0%,100%,.2);margin-bottom:1.5rem}.svc-closer-headline{font-family:Cormorant Garamond,serif;font-weight:300;font-size:clamp(2.2rem,4.5vw,4rem);color:var(--white);line-height:1.15;margin-bottom:1.25rem}.svc-closer-headline em{font-style:italic;color:var(--film)}.svc-closer-sub{font-size:.85rem;color:hsla(0,0%,100%,.3);margin-bottom:3rem}@media (max-width:768px){.svc-closer{padding:5rem 1.5rem!important}}